[
Login
] [
Register
]
|
Contact us
|
中文
Home
Search Parts
Vehicle
Product
Member
Suppliers
Hot Searches
1026347
1087151
1133438
1479972080
1489139080
1489800080
1705AQ
1705ER
1705QK
170674
or
Post Buying Request
Suppliers
BALDWIN
BF833
Find The OE Number:
269212
BALDWIN
BF833-K2
Find The OE Number:
269212
DENCKERMANN
A130007
Find The OE Number:
269212
DENCKERMANN
A130008
Find The OE Number:
269212
KAMOKA
F300901
PURFLUX
EP103
TECNOCAR
B7
WIX FILTERS
33031
WIX FILTERS
33001